Completed a Tail/Stop/Turn conversion with LED inserts and red lenses to the rear turn signals.
I used 1157 style inserts and added a common 3 wire to 2 wire trailer light module to make it work.
Installed a bright red LED bulb in the center taillight, another LED bulb in the rear fender tip light.
Now the bike has all LED lighting. (and I need to update the photo below)

Installed a Trask CheckM8 vented transmission cover. Fairly straightforward install. Actually, the hardest part was transferring the transmission vent hose over from the stock cover to the new one.

Today I installed Drag Specialties 13" black heavy duty adjustable rear shocks on my 20 RKS. First test ride was very nice and a noticeable improvement! Not bad for $275.00 and free shipping.
